Subtract 56/45 from 14/12
1st number: 1 2/12, 2nd number: 1 11/45
14/12 - 56/45 is -7/90.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 12 and 45 is 180
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 180 - For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 15 = 180,
14/12 = 14 × 15/12 × 15 = 210/180 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 45 × 4 = 180,
56/45 = 56 × 4/45 × 4 = 224/180 - Subtract the two like fractions:
210/180 - 224/180 = 210 - 224/180 = -14/180 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-7/90
